About E. Kebebe

E. Kebebe is a scholar working on General Agricultural and Biological Sciences, Nutrition and Dietetics, Ecology, Evolution, Behavior and Systematics, Ecology and Safety Research, having authored 10 papers that have together received 277 indexed citations. Recurring topics across this work include Agricultural Innovations and Practices (7 papers), Child Nutrition and Water Access (3 papers), Agriculture and Rural Development Research (2 papers), Poverty, Education, and Child Welfare (2 papers), Agriculture Sustainability and Environmental Impact (2 papers), Rangeland Management and Livestock Ecology (2 papers), Agriculture, Land Use, Rural Development (2 papers) and Water resources management and optimization (1 paper). The work is most often cited by research in General Agricultural and Biological Sciences (118 citations), Business and International Management (20 citations), Animal Science and Zoology (30 citations), Soil Science (28 citations) and Ecology, Evolution, Behavior and Systematics (50 citations). E. Kebebe has collaborated with scholars based in Netherlands, Ethiopia and Kenya. Frequent co-authors include S.J. Oosting, I.J.M. de Boer, Laurens Klerkx, Alan J. Duncan, Getahun Legesse, K. M. Wittenberg, Faith A. Omonijo, Marcos R. C. Cordeiro, Kim Stanford and Tim A. McAllister. Their work appears in journals such as Forest Policy and Economics, Food Security, Australian Journal of Agricultural and Resource Economics, Technology in Society and Agricultural Systems.
